chs-physics-report – Physics lab reports for Carmel High School
This package may optionally be used by students at Carmel High School in Indiana in the United States to write physics lab reports for FW physics courses. As many students are beginners at LaTeX, it also attempts to simplify the report-writing process by offering macros for commonly used notation and by automatically formatting the documents for students who will only use TeX for mathematics and not typesetting.
The package depends on amsmath, calc, fancyhdr, geometry, graphicx, letltxmacro, titlesec, transparent, and xcolor.
